
Claude Skill로 AI 음성을 Claude·Cursor에 자연어 한 줄로 연동하는 법
Claude Code나 Cursor에서 Skill 없이 음성 기능을 연동할 때, 작업의 절반은 공식 문서를 LLM에 전달하는 일입니다. API 레퍼런스를 붙여넣고, 음성 ID를 찾아주고, 403·402 오류 코드를 다시 설명하는 일이 매번 반복되죠.
이러한 반복 작업을 효율화하기 위해 타입캐스트 API 팀이 5월 typecast-api-expert Skill을 공개했습니다. Claude Code·Cursor·GitHub Copilot에서 한 줄 설치로 동작하는 Anthropic Skill 표준 패키지입니다.
오늘 아티클, 이런 분들에게 추천드립니다
✅ Claude Code·Cursor로 음성 기능을 붙이는 개발자
✅ 자연어 한 줄로 “슬픈 한국어 여성 보이스, 스트리밍으로” 같은 지시를 내리고 코드를 받고 싶은 분
✅ LLM에 매번 Typecast TTS API 문서를 복붙하는 게 번거로운 콘텐츠 자동화 팀
Skill이 뭔가요?
Skill은 LLM이 필요할 때만 불러쓰는 모듈화된 전문 지식 패키지입니다. 폴더 하나에 SKILL.md(시스템 프롬프트 + 사용 가이드)와 보조 자료(scripts/, references/, assets/)를 담아두면, Claude가 사용자의 의도를 보고 그 폴더를 자동으로 읽어옵니다.
핵심은 두 가지입니다.
두 필드만으로 트리거를 정의합니다
name과 description만 있으면 LLM이 언제 이 스킬을 불러올지 스스로 결정합니다. 사용자가 따로 호출하지 않아도 의도 매칭으로 자동 활성화되는 구조죠.
필요한 순간에만 선택적으로 로딩됩니다
컨텍스트 창에 항상 떠 있는 게 아니라, 필요한 순간에만 호출됩니다. 토큰 낭비 없이 필요한 순간에만 전문 지식이 붙는 구조라 LLM 응답 속도·비용에 부담이 없습니다.
---
name: typecast-api-expert
description: Typecast TTS API expert agent. Provides API key setup,
code samples (Python, JavaScript, cURL), error troubleshooting, and
plan comparison.
---
위 프론트매터가 typecast-api-expert Skill의 진입점입니다. 사용자가 “TTS 코드 짜줘”라고만 입력해도 Claude가 description을 읽고 이 Skill을 자동으로 활성화합니다.
Typecast TTS Skill이 IDE 안에서 해주는 일
이 Skill은 IDE 안의 타입캐스트 TTS 전문가입니다. 자연어 한 줄로 의도만 전하면, 적절한 모델·음성 ID·감정 파라미터까지 잡힌 AI 음성 연동 코드가 나옵니다. 음성 옵션을 일일이 검색하거나 LLM에 따로 알려줄 필요 없어요.
한마디로 AI 음성을 자연어 한 줄로 서비스에 연동할 수 있는 거죠. Skill이 커버하는 영역은 세 가지로 정리됩니다.
① 자동 코드 작성
시작하기 · API 키 발급, 환경변수 설정, 첫 호출
코드 샘플 · Python·JavaScript·cURL 즉시 생성
Streaming TTS · 합성과 동시에 청크 전송하는 패턴
자막 생성 · SRT·VTT 포맷으로 음성과 동기화된 캡션 출력
② 디테일한 세팅 자동조절
음량 정규화 · target_lufs 파라미터로 방송·플랫폼 기준 자동 맞춤
Smart Emotion · 텍스트 맥락 기반 감정 자동 감지(ssfm 3.0 기준, 7개 프리셋)
다국어 분기 · 37개 언어 중 사용 환경에 맞는 언어 코드 자동 추천
③ 트러블 슈팅
오류 처리 · 400·401·402·403·404·429 응답별 원인과 해결 흐름
플랜 비교 · Web 플랜과 API 플랜의 차이, Starter 키 비호환(403) 자동 진단
응답 언어는 사용 언어와 자동으로 동기화됩니다. 한국어로 물어보면 한국어로, 영어로 물어보면 영어로 답합니다. 별도 설정이 필요 없습니다.
Typecast Skill 설치 방법 — 1분이면 됩니다
설치 방식은 IDE·툴 환경에 따라 세 가지가 있습니다. 가장 빠른 건 Claude Code의 플러그인 명령어 한 줄(/plugin install typecast-api-expert@typecast-skills)입니다. SKILL.md 원문·라이선스는 GitHub 저장소, 카탈로그 페이지는 skills.sh에서 확인할 수 있어요.
1)Claude Code (권장)
/plugin marketplace add neosapience/typecast-skills
/plugin install typecast-api-expert@typecast-skills
2)Cursor·기타 skills.sh 호환 에이전트
skills.sh는 Anthropic의 Agent Skills 표준을 따르는 오픈 스킬 카탈로그입니다. Cursor를 비롯해 이 디렉토리 규약을 지원하는 에이전트라면 아래 한 줄로 설치할 수 있어요.
npx skills add neosapience/typecast-skills
※ Cursor에서는 Auto 모드 사용, Gemini 2.5 Flash은 권장하지 않습니다. 스킬의 description 매칭과 컨텍스트 처리 품질 차이로 인해 파라미터 자동 세팅이나 오류 진단이 불완전하게 동작할 수 있습니다.
3)수동 설치
저장소를 클론한 뒤 환경에 맞는 디렉토리로 복사합니다.
| 환경 | 경로 |
|---|---|
| 개인용 (전역) | ~/.claude/skills/typecast-api-expert/ |
| 프로젝트 단위 | .cursor/skills/typecast-api-expert/ |
설치 후 IDE를 재시작하면 description 매칭이 활성화됩니다. 별도 설정 화면 없이, 다음 채팅부터 바로 동작합니다.
실전 — Skill 설치 전·후 Claude Code 비교
설치 전과 후가 어떻게 달라지는지 같은 의도의 프롬프트로 비교해봤습니다.
Before — 스킬 미사용 시
나: Typecast API로 슬픈 한국어 여성 음성 코드 짜줘.
Claude: 어느 모델인가요? voice_id는 무엇으로 할까요?
공식 문서 URL을 알려주시면 그에 맞춰 작성하겠습니다.
문서 URL을 다시 던지고, 모델명을 검색해서 알려주고, 음성 ID 목록을 따로 찾아 붙여넣어야 합니다. 그제야 코드가 나옵니다.
After — 스킬 설치 후
나: Typecast API로 슬픈 한국어 여성 음성 코드 짜줘.
Claude: ssfm 3.0 모델 + Smart Emotion으로 작성합니다.
한국어 여성 화자 voice_id 추천 3개 함께 드릴게요.
API 키는 환경변수 TYPECAST_API_KEY로 분리했습니다.
[Python 코드 출력]
LLM이 모델·감정·보안 패턴까지 한 번에 결정합니다. 사용자가 의식하지 않아도 target_lufs·emotion_type 같은 권장 파라미터가 자연스럽게 들어가고, 키를 클라이언트 코드에 노출하지 않는 보안 패턴까지 적용됩니다.
💡 자동화 파이프라인에서도 동일하게 동작합니다
콘텐츠 자동화 팀이 n8n에 Claude Agent 노드를 두고 “이 스크립트를 슬픈 톤으로 합성해서 S3에 올려줘” 같은 명령을 넣으면, 스킬이 합성 → target_lufs 정규화 → 업로드 흐름을 한 번에 코드로 짜냅니다. 하루 수백 개 숏폼을 자동 생성하는 파이프라인에서, Skill은 LLM이 매번 Typecast 문서를 다시 읽지 않아도 되도록 만드는 핵심 요소죠.
FAQ. 자주 묻는 질문
Q. Skill과 MCP는 뭐가 다른가요? +
MCP는 외부 도구를 LLM이 직접 호출하는 프로토콜, Skill은 LLM이 참고하는 도메인 지식 패키지입니다. 가장 큰 차이는 컨텍스트 점유 방식입니다. 문서를 수동으로 붙여넣으면 항상 컨텍스트를 차지하고, MCP는 도구 정의가 항상 떠 있는 반면, Skill은 호출 전엔 0, 호출 후에만 점유합니다. 두 방식은 함께 쓸 수 있고, typecast-api-expert는 Skill 방식으로 별도 서버 실행 없이 폴더 설치만으로 동작합니다.
Q. Typecast API 키는 어디서 발급하나요? +
typecast.ai/developers/api에서 발급합니다. 무료 플랜은 카드 등록 없이 월 30,000 크레딧이 제공됩니다. 타입캐스트 스킬을 쓰면 보안에 민감한 API 키를 환경변수로 분리·관리하는 패턴까지 자동으로 적용해줍니다.
Q. 어떤 IDE·에이전트에서 Typecast 스킬이 동작하나요? +
Claude Code, Cursor, GitHub Copilot, 그리고 skills.sh 디렉토리를 따르는 모든 에이전트에서 동작합니다.
Q. Typecast TTS API 장점은 무엇인가요? +
타입캐스트는 MRR 기준 국내 1위 음성/영상 생성형 AI SaaS 스타트업입니다. API 관점의 핵심 강점은 세 가지로 정리됩니다. ① 자연스러움 — 전문 성우 녹음 + Smart Emotion 자동 감정(텍스트 맥락 인식) + ssfm 3.0 모델이 결합돼 6개 언어에서 원어민급 음성을 구현합니다. ② 다양성 — 500개 AI 캐릭터 보이스와 37개 언어를 단일 API에서 호출할 수 있어 글로벌 서비스에 그대로 확장됩니다. ③ 안정성 — Streaming TTS는 치지직 라이브 환경에서 검증된 것처럼 수만 명 동시접속 환경에서도 레이턴시 없이 동작합니다.
Skill은 “문서 읽는 시간”을 코드 짜는 시간으로 돌려줍니다
API 통합에서 진짜 비용은 코드 작성이 아니라 문서를 LLM에 어떻게 전달할지를 고민하는 시간이었습니다. Skill 방식은 그 단계 자체를 없앱니다. 한 번 설치하면 다음 프로젝트에서도, 동료의 IDE에서도 같은 전문가가 늘 함께합니다.
타입캐스트 API,
지금 바로 시작해보세요
typecast-api-expert 스킬을 IDE에 설치하고, 무료 API 키로 첫 음성을 만들어보세요.
카드 등록 없이 월 30,000 크레딧을 바로 사용할 수 있습니다.






